Farm insurance agents in Hartsdale New York help local farmers protect their operations. New York law requires farms with employees to carry workers compensation insurance. Agents can guide you through coverage options for barns equipment and liability specific to the region.

What Does a Farm Insurance Agent in Hartsdale Cost?

The cost of farm insurance in New York varies widely. A small hobby farm might pay 500 to 1,500 dollars per year for basic coverage. A larger commercial farm could pay 5,000 to 15,000 dollars or more annually. Factors include farm size location and types of crops or livestock. This is general information not insurance advice.

What does a farm insurance agent in Hartsdale do?
A farm insurance agent helps you choose policies for your farm. They assess risks like weather damage and equipment loss. They also explain New York state requirements for farm insurance.
Is farm insurance required in New York?
New York does not require general farm insurance by law. However lenders often require it for mortgages. Also if you have employees you must carry workers compensation insurance under New York Workers Compensation Law.
What types of farm insurance are available in Hartsdale?
Common types include property insurance for buildings and equipment. Liability insurance covers injuries on your farm. Crop insurance protects against yield loss from weather or pests.
